Busy Berlusconi

I loathe politics but I’m fascinated by Italy, which prompted me recently to read a bio of Italian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i. Although he’s had a blustery, scandal-ridden political career, the story of his early years is endearing to me.

Did you know Berlusconi paid his way through law school in the late 1950s by selling vacuum cleaners in residential neighborhoods and working singing gigs aboard cruise liners? And that his preliminary vocation focused not on practicing law but on building businesses? Milano 2, a modern suburb of his home city of Milan, was his brainchild during the 1960s. He also became a television magnate.

I have no opinions about his politics (having never examined them), but any guy who worked his way through college as a vac salesman and semipro entertainer has to warrant some repect (IMHO).
